menes meaning

Meaning of menes

What is the full meaning of menes

MENE, (Scots) to lament, moan, also MEANE, MEIN [v]

Example of the word menes placed on a Scrabble board.

Unscrambled word menes

Points for menes

Scrabble
8 points
Word With Friends
9 points
Wordfeud
8 points